openQA is consistently failing on the desktop_login test, across multiple tries, on both x86_64 and aarch64. After some preparation steps - blanking out the background and adding a couple of test user accounts, 'jim' and 'jack' - the test reboots the system, logs in as 'jack', and logs out. At that point, it seems that plasma-login-greeter crashes and we end up at a text console instead of the login screen.
The backtrace of the crash shows it running through QMessageLogger::fatal (meaning it's a kind of "intentional crash" on a known fatal condition), with the log message "This application failed to start because no Qt platform plugin could be initialized. Reinstalling the application may fix this problem." In the system logs, we see this:
Jul 14 18:45:25 fedora kwin_wayland[2358]: No backend specified, automatically choosing drm
Jul 14 18:45:25 fedora kwin_wayland[2358]: Accepting client connections on sockets: QList("wayland-0")
Jul 14 18:45:25 fedora kwin_wayland[2358]: Failed to open /dev/dri/card1 device (Device or resource busy)
<same error repeats 30 times or so>
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ora kwin_wayland[2358]: Failed to open drm device /dev/dri/card1
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ora kwin_wayland[2358]: No suitable DRM devices have been found
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ora systemd[2297]: plasma-login-kwin_wayland.service: Main process exited, code=exited, status=1/FAILURE
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ora systemd[2297]: plasma-login-kwin_wayland.service: Failed with result 'exit-code'.
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ora systemd[2297]: Failed to start plasma-login-kwin_wayland.service - KDE Window Manager (Login Manager Version).
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ora systemd[2297]: Dependency failed for plasma-login-wayland.target.
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ora systemd[2297]: plasma-login-wayland.target: Job plasma-login-wayland.target/start failed with result 'dependency'.
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ora systemd[2297]: Started plasma-login.service - Plasma Login.
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ora systemd[2297]: Started plasma-wallpaper.service - Plasma Wallpaper on Login screen.
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ora plasma-login-greeter[2361]: Failed to create wl_display (Connection refused)
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ora plasma-login-wallpaper[2362]: Failed to create wl_display (Connection refused)
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ora plasma-login-wallpaper[2362]: Could not load the Qt platform plugin "wayland" in "" even though it was found.
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ora plasma-login-greeter[2361]: Could not load the Qt platform plugin "wayland" in "" even though it was found.
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ora plasma-login-greeter[2361]: could not connect to display
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ora plasma-login-wallpaper[2362]: could not connect to display
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ora plasma-login-wallpaper[2362]: From 6.5.0, xcb-cursor0 or libxcb-cursor0 is needed to load the Qt xcb platform plugin.
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ora plasma-login-wallpaper[2362]: Could not load the Qt platform plugin "xcb" in "" even though it was found.
Jul 14 18:45:30 fedora plasma-login-wallpaper[2362]: This application failed to start because no Qt platform plugin could be initialized. Reinstalling the application may fix this problem.
As I said, this seems reliable within openQA. It failed the same way three times each on x86_64 and aarch64, on both prod and staging - so 12 identical failures in total. The same test does not fail on previous or subsequent updates, so it really does appear to be caused by this update.
On the difference between F44 and Rawhide (the same test fails on F44 but much later, so the logout crash doesn't happen there) - Rawhide has kernel 7.2, F44 has 7.1. I can probably hack things up to test F44 with F45's kernel and see if that makes the logout crash happen.

It seems like reverting b49a7c471e05f7c5f098c0e16461ca5133380d08 - the backport of https://invent.kde.org/plasma/plasma-login-manager/-/merge_requests/151/ - avoids the crash. That was a shot in the dark, but it seems to have hit. I've tried three runs with the revert and they all got past the crash, and two additional runs without the revert which both crashed.
